|
@@ -3,7 +3,22 @@
|
|
|
|
|
|
<?php
|
|
<?php
|
|
$branch = 'dev';
|
|
$branch = 'dev';
|
|
-$availableSeasons = array("RHO2018", "NNBAR2021");
|
|
|
|
|
|
+
|
|
|
|
+function getsmth($branch){
|
|
|
|
+ $url = "https://cmd.inp.nsk.su/~compton/gitlist/compton_tables/raw/".$branch."/tables/";
|
|
|
|
+ $text = file_get_contents($url);
|
|
|
|
+ $arrays = explode("\n", $text);
|
|
|
|
+ $clean_arrs = array_filter($arrays, function($value){
|
|
|
|
+ $temp_arr = explode('/', $value);
|
|
|
|
+ return preg_match("/[A-Z]+[0-9]+\//", $value);
|
|
|
|
+ });
|
|
|
|
+ foreach($clean_arrs as &$val){
|
|
|
|
+ $val = substr($val, 0, -1);
|
|
|
|
+ }
|
|
|
|
+ return $clean_arrs;
|
|
|
|
+}
|
|
|
|
+
|
|
|
|
+$availableSeasons = getsmth($branch);
|
|
|
|
|
|
$season = isset($_GET["season"])&&in_array($_GET["season"], $availableSeasons) ? $_GET["season"] : reset($availableSeasons);
|
|
$season = isset($_GET["season"])&&in_array($_GET["season"], $availableSeasons) ? $_GET["season"] : reset($availableSeasons);
|
|
$url = "https://cmd.inp.nsk.su/~compton/gitlist/compton_tables/raw/".$branch."/tables/".$season."/";
|
|
$url = "https://cmd.inp.nsk.su/~compton/gitlist/compton_tables/raw/".$branch."/tables/".$season."/";
|